Building Incredible Cosplay Armor with Dimensional Printing The realm of cosplay has seen a transformation , particularly in the creation of armor. Employing 3D printing technology, cosplayers can now fabricate incredibly detailed and realistic pieces that were once only achievable through painstaking traditional methods like Worbla crafting. This process typically involves designing armor components in software such as Blender or Fusion 360, then printing them out using a resin or filament printer. Post-processing includes tasks like sanding, filling, and painting to achieve the desired finish—a truly rewarding journey for any devoted cosplayer looking to elevate their costume from good to absolutely breathtaking . Designing & Building Cosplay Armor: The Power of 3D Modeling Creating amazing cosplay armor has never been easier with the rise of 3D modeling software. Previously, crafting such elaborate pieces required significant hand-sculpting read more and traditional fabrication techniques— a very laborious process. Now, cosplayers can design armor components digitally, making alterations and refinements with great precision. This approach not only allows for intricate and complex designs that would be too difficult to replicate physically, but also facilitates the generation of 3D printing files or templates for crafting using materials like EVA foam, Worbla, or even full-scale fabrication. The ability to preview a design from every angle before any physical work begins is a substantial advantage, reducing waste and leading to more professional and detailed armor finishes – ultimately empowering cosplayers of all skill levels to bring their vision to life.
